[Bug 79028] "write dvd" fails w/: "File image creation failed Unknown Error"

2007-01-12 Thread Lakin Wecker
Public bug reported:

Binary package hint: nautilus-cd-burner

If you have a file (anywhere in the target burning files) named with the single 
character: \   
then nautilus will fail with the following message:

File image creation failed

Unknown error

I would assume this is due to an underlying program, but not being
familiar with the process I can't confirm which program is actually
causing the bug.

However, "Unknown error" is a very frustrating message, especially as
there is no recommendation to the user as to how to fix the problem.  So
I'd like this report to stay open on nautilus-cd-burner, although
perhaps as a low priority.

Unknown errors could prompt the user to report a bug and gather the list
of files/filesizes that they were going to burn.

[Bug 78985] Re: Make totem-xine the default for totem

2007-01-12 Thread Sebastien Bacher
Thank you for you bug. We will keep totem-gstreamer by default though
because gstreamer is the multimedia framework used by GNOME and because
xine doesn't work better on free formats (which is what we can ship on
the default installation). DVD playing lacks from gstreamer, that's a
known problem and going to be worked, for w32codecs you can install
gstreamer0.10-pitfdll. gstreamer is also providing a consistent user
experience with GNOME

[Bug 58083] Re: No keyboard previews

2007-01-12 Thread Sebastien Bacher
Fixed with that upload:

 xorg-server (1:1.1.1-0ubuntu13) feisty; urgency=low
 .
   * 19_revert_xkb_change_breaking_XkbGetKeyboard.patch:
 - patch from fedora (with extra Makefile.in change), revert change that
   broke XkbGetKeyboard() (Ubuntu: #58083)
   * 37_Fix-__glXDRIbindTexImage-for-32-bpp-on-big-endian-platforms.diff:
 - upstream patch copied from the Debian package, fix blue screen with
   compiz on ppc (Ubuntu: #58373)
